Hardison & Cochran | Injury & Workers Comp Lawyers has been named a 2025 Raleigh's Best winner, earning Silver in the Best Personal Injury Law Firm category. This annual program, presented by The News & Observer, invites local residents to vote for the businesses and organizations they trust most, highlighting firms that make a difference in the community. The recognition holds significant meaning for the Hardison & Cochran team, as it directly reflects the confidence and appreciation of the Raleigh community.
Ben Cochran, managing partner of Hardison & Cochran, emphasized the importance of this award, stating that it came directly from the people of Raleigh. He noted that the firm has been built on the belief that every client deserves to be heard and treated with respect, and community recognition validates these efforts. This acknowledgment underscores the firm's commitment to client-centered legal services, which is crucial in personal injury and workers' compensation cases where individuals often face life-altering circumstances.
The firm represents clients across North Carolina in personal injury, workers' compensation, and Social Security Disability cases, assisting people in rebuilding their lives after serious accidents. With over 40 years of experience, Hardison & Cochran has grown from one small office in Dunn, North Carolina, to six offices across the state, including locations in Raleigh, Greensboro, Fayetteville, Greenville, Wilmington, and Dunn.
